Apple iPhone 17 Air: Thinner Than a Pen, Packed Like a Pro
|
Apple has gone thinner than ever with its new iPhone 17 Air, a handset that measures just 5.6 mm — slimmer than most pens on your desk. Yet inside this razor-thin frame, Apple has packed the kind of hardware it usually reserves for its Pro line. CEO Tim Cook described it as “pro performance in a thin and light design.” Beyond the numbers, the iPhone 17 Air represents more than just another spec bump; it signals Apple’s move toward bold redesigns instead of the incremental yearly updates that have long defined the iPhone. |
Sleek Design, Bold Shades
One of the first things people will notice is not just the size, but the shades Apple chose this year. The iPhone 17 Air comes in Space Black, Cloud White, Light Gold, and Sky Blue.

Strong, Slim, and Bright
The iPhone 17 Air is more than just a pretty frame. At just 5.6 mm thick, it is Apple’s thinnest iPhone yet, crafted with a titanium frame and protected by Ceramic Shield 2 on both sides.
Its 6.5-inch ProMotion display offers a buttery-smooth 120Hz refresh rate and a dazzling 3,000 nits peak brightness, ensuring effortless outdoor visibility.
Despite the ultra-slim build, Apple claims up to 40 hours of video playback, thanks to advanced battery optimization and the removal of the physical SIM slot — the iPhone 17 Air is eSIM-only.
Power Under the Hood
Apple debuts the A19 Pro chip with the iPhone 17 Air, backed by a faster C1x modem and the all-new N1 chip that supports Wi-Fi 7, Bluetooth 6, and Thread. The result is a lightweight phone that doesn’t compromise on speed or performance.
Camera Upgrades
Photography and video also get a boost:
-
48MP dual rear system with a 12MP telephoto lens
-
18MP front camera with Centre Stage, keeping you perfectly framed in video calls
The iPhone 17 Air ships with iOS 26, which introduces Apple’s new “Liquid Glass” design language across the interface.
